#!/bin/bash
set -o errexit # Exit the script with error if any of the commands fail
# Supported/used environment variables:
# SET_XTRACE_ON Set to non-empty to write all commands first to stderr.
# AUTH Set to enable authentication. Defaults to "noauth"
# SSL Set to enable SSL. Defaults to "nossl"
# PYTHON_BINARY The Python version to use. Defaults to whatever is available
# GREEN_FRAMEWORK The green framework to test with, if any.
# C_EXTENSIONS Pass --no_ext to setup.py, or not.
# COVERAGE If non-empty, run the test suite with coverage.
# TEST_ENCRYPTION If non-empty, install pymongocrypt.
# LIBMONGOCRYPT_URL The URL to download libmongocrypt.
if [ -n "${SET_XTRACE_ON}" ]; then
set -o xtrace
else
set +x
fi
AUTH=${AUTH:-noauth}
SSL=${SSL:-nossl}
PYTHON_BINARY=${PYTHON_BINARY:-}
GREEN_FRAMEWORK=${GREEN_FRAMEWORK:-}
C_EXTENSIONS=${C_EXTENSIONS:-}
COVERAGE=${COVERAGE:-}
COMPRESSORS=${COMPRESSORS:-}
MONGODB_API_VERSION=${MONGODB_API_VERSION:-}
TEST_ENCRYPTION=${TEST_ENCRYPTION:-}
LIBMONGOCRYPT_URL=${LIBMONGOCRYPT_URL:-}
DATA_LAKE=${DATA_LAKE:-}
if [ -n "$COMPRESSORS" ]; then
export COMPRESSORS=$COMPRESSORS
fi
if [ -n "$MONGODB_API_VERSION" ]; then
export MONGODB_API_VERSION=$MONGODB_API_VERSION
fi
if [ "$AUTH" != "noauth" ]; then
if [ -z "$DATA_LAKE" ]; then
export DB_USER="bob"
export DB_PASSWORD="pwd123"
else
export DB_USER="mhuser"
export DB_PASSWORD="pencil"
fi
fi
if [ "$SSL" != "nossl" ]; then
export CLIENT_PEM="$DRIVERS_TOOLS/.evergreen/x509gen/client.pem"
export CA_PEM="$DRIVERS_TOOLS/.evergreen/x509gen/ca.pem"
if [ -n "$TEST_LOADBALANCER" ]; then
export SINGLE_MONGOS_LB_URI="${SINGLE_MONGOS_LB_URI}&tls=true"
export MULTI_MONGOS_LB_URI="${MULTI_MONGOS_LB_URI}&tls=true"
fi
fi
# For createvirtualenv.
. .evergreen/utils.sh
if [ -z "$PYTHON_BINARY" ]; then
# Use Python 3 from the server toolchain to test on ARM, POWER or zSeries if a
# system python3 doesn't exist or exists but is older than 3.6.
if is_python_36 $(command -v python3); then
PYTHON=$(command -v python3)
elif is_python_36 $(command -v /opt/mongodbtoolchain/v2/bin/python3); then
PYTHON=$(command -v /opt/mongodbtoolchain/v2/bin/python3)
else
echo "Cannot test without python3.6+ installed!"
fi
elif [ "$COMPRESSORS" = "snappy" ]; then
$PYTHON_BINARY -m virtualenv --never-download snappytest
. snappytest/bin/activate
trap "deactivate; rm -rf snappytest" EXIT HUP
# 0.5.2 has issues in pypy3(.5)
pip install python-snappy==0.5.1
PYTHON=python
elif [ "$COMPRESSORS" = "zstd" ]; then
$PYTHON_BINARY -m virtualenv --never-download zstdtest
. zstdtest/bin/activate
trap "deactivate; rm -rf zstdtest" EXIT HUP
pip install zstandard
PYTHON=python
else
PYTHON="$PYTHON_BINARY"
fi
# PyOpenSSL test setup.
if [ -n "$TEST_PYOPENSSL" ]; then
createvirtualenv $PYTHON pyopenssltest
trap "deactivate; rm -rf pyopenssltest" EXIT HUP
PYTHON=python
python -m pip install --prefer-binary pyopenssl requests service_identity
fi
if [ -n "$TEST_ENCRYPTION" ]; then
createvirtualenv $PYTHON venv-encryption
trap "deactivate; rm -rf venv-encryption" EXIT HUP
PYTHON=python
if [ "Windows_NT" = "$OS" ]; then # Magic variable in cygwin
$PYTHON -m pip install -U setuptools
fi
if [ -z "$LIBMONGOCRYPT_URL" ]; then
echo "Cannot test client side encryption without LIBMONGOCRYPT_URL!"
exit 1
fi
curl -O "$LIBMONGOCRYPT_URL"
mkdir libmongocrypt
tar xzf libmongocrypt.tar.gz -C ./libmongocrypt
ls -la libmongocrypt
ls -la libmongocrypt/nocrypto
# Use the nocrypto build to avoid dependency issues with older windows/python versions.
BASE=$(pwd)/libmongocrypt/nocrypto
if [ -f "${BASE}/lib/libmongocrypt.so" ]; then
export PYMONGOCRYPT_LIB=${BASE}/lib/libmongocrypt.so
elif [ -f "${BASE}/lib/libmongocrypt.dylib" ]; then
export PYMONGOCRYPT_LIB=${BASE}/lib/libmongocrypt.dylib
elif [ -f "${BASE}/bin/mongocrypt.dll" ]; then
PYMONGOCRYPT_LIB=${BASE}/bin/mongocrypt.dll
# libmongocrypt's windows dll is not marked executable.
chmod +x $PYMONGOCRYPT_LIB
export PYMONGOCRYPT_LIB=$(cygpath -m $PYMONGOCRYPT_LIB)
elif [ -f "${BASE}/lib64/libmongocrypt.so" ]; then
export PYMONGOCRYPT_LIB=${BASE}/lib64/libmongocrypt.so
else
echo "Cannot find libmongocrypt shared object file"
exit 1
fi
# TODO: Test with 'pip install pymongocrypt'
git clone --branch master https://github.com/mongodb/libmongocrypt.git libmongocrypt_git
python -m pip install --prefer-binary -r .evergreen/test-encryption-requirements.txt
python -m pip install ./libmongocrypt_git/bindings/python
python -c "import pymongocrypt; print('pymongocrypt version: '+pymongocrypt.__version__)"
python -c "import pymongocrypt; print('libmongocrypt version: '+pymongocrypt.libmongocrypt_version())"
# PATH is updated by PREPARE_SHELL for access to mongocryptd.
# Get access to the AWS temporary credentials:
# CSFLE_AWS_TEMP_ACCESS_KEY_ID, CSFLE_AWS_TEMP_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Y, CSFLE_AWS_TEMP_SESSION_TOKEN
. $DRIVERS_TOOLS/.evergreen/csfle/set-temp-creds.sh
# Start the mock KMS servers.
if [ "$OS" = "Windows_NT" ]; then
# Remove after BUILD-13574.
python -m pip install certifi
fi
pushd ${DRIVERS_TOOLS}/.evergreen/csfle
python -u lib/kms_http_server.py --ca_file ../x509gen/ca.pem --cert_file ../x509gen/expired.pem --port 8000 &
python -u lib/kms_http_server.py --ca_file ../x509gen/ca.pem --cert_file ../x509gen/wrong-host.pem --port 8001 &
trap 'kill $(jobs -p)' EXIT HUP
popd
fi
if [ -z "$DATA_LAKE" ]; then
TEST_ARGS=""
else
TEST_ARGS="-s test.test_data_lake"
fi
# Don't download unittest-xml-reporting from pypi, which often fails.
if $PYTHON -c "import xmlrunner"; then
# The xunit output dir must be a Python style absolute path.
XUNIT_DIR="$(pwd)/xunit-results"
if [ "Windows_NT" = "$OS" ]; then # Magic variable in cygwin
XUNIT_DIR=$(cygpath -m $XUNIT_DIR)
fi
OUTPUT="--xunit-output=${XUNIT_DIR}"
else
OUTPUT=""
fi
echo "Running $AUTH tests over $SSL with python $PYTHON"
$PYTHON -c 'import sys; print(sys.version)'
# Run the tests, and store the results in Evergreen compatible XUnit XML
# files in the xunit-results/ directory.
# Run the tests with coverage if requested and coverage is installed.
# Only cover CPython. PyPy reports suspiciously low coverage.
PYTHON_IMPL=$($PYTHON -c "import platform; print(platform.python_implementation())")
COVERAGE_ARGS=""
if [ -n "$COVERAGE" -a $PYTHON_IMPL = "CPython" ]; then
if $PYTHON -m coverage --version; then
echo "INFO: coverage is installed, running tests with coverage..."
COVERAGE_ARGS="-m coverage run --branch"
else
echo "INFO: coverage is not installed, running tests without coverage..."
fi
fi
$PYTHON setup.py clean
if [ -z "$GREEN_FRAMEWORK" ]; then
if [ -z "$C_EXTENSIONS" -a $PYTHON_IMPL = "CPython" ]; then
# Fail if the C extensions fail to build.
# This always sets 0 for exit status, even if the build fails, due
# to our hack to install PyMongo without C extensions when build
# deps aren't available.
$PYTHON setup.py build_ext -i
# This will set a non-zero exit status if either import fails,
# causing this script to exit.
$PYTHON -c "from bson import _cbson; from pymongo import _cmessage"
fi
$PYTHON $COVERAGE_ARGS setup.py $C_EXTENSIONS test $TEST_ARGS $OUTPUT
else
# --no_ext has to come before "test" so there is no way to toggle extensions here.
$PYTHON green_framework_test.py $GREEN_FRAMEWORK $OUTPUT
fi
